What Are Low Wager Casinos, Anyway?
Let’s get this out of the way—low wager casinos aren’t giving money away. What they are doing is offering more realistic conditions. Instead of asking you to play through a bonus 50 times before seeing a cent, you’re looking at rollover requirements in the range of 1x to 20x.
That’s a big shift. Suddenly, a $100 bonus might actually feel like $100, not a digital carrot you’ll never catch. The catch? These bonuses are often smaller, more controlled, and tucked behind clear terms. And that’s a good thing.

Strategy: Playing Smart to Beat the Wager
You can’t just click your way to a withdrawal. If you want to maximise your chances with a low wager bonus, you need to play it with a bit of sense. And no, it doesn’t involve magic tricks—just a few good habits.
Here’s a list worth keeping in your back pocket:
- Choose pokies that contribute 100% to wagering progress.
- Pick high RTP games (96% and up) to improve long-term value.
- Avoid volatile slots if you’re working with a small balance.
- Stick to minimum qualifying deposits to stay in control.
- Play steadily—don’t blast through spins hoping for a miracle.
Even just a few of these tweaks can turn a losing bonus into a potential payout. Low wager means less risk, but it still pays to have a plan.
